7. Practice Safe Oral Sex

If you’re engaging in oral sex, it’s essential to practice safe techniques to reduce the risk of sexually transmitted infections (STIs). This includes using barriers like flavored condoms or dental dams to protect against infections. Regular STI testing is also highly recommended for sexually active individuals.

Psychology and Consent in Lick Sex

As with any sexual activity, consent and communication are vital components of lick sex. It’s essential to establish boundaries, discuss likes and dislikes, and ensure that both partners are comfortable with the experience.

Importance of Consent

Consent involves mutual agreement and understanding between partners before engaging in any sexual activity. Always ask for permission and respect your partner’s boundaries.

Open Communication

Encouraging an open dialogue with your partner about expectations, desires, boundaries, and safe words can improve overall experience. Discuss fantasies or desires openly, and don’t hesitate to check in during the act to ensure comfort and pleasure.

Encouraging Trust and Safety

Creating a trusting environment is crucial. Partners should feel safe expressing discomfort or changing their minds during intimate moments. Establishing a safe word can contribute to feelings of security, ensuring that both partners feel protected and understood.
